Software Engineers Mar21

Share This

Software Engineers



Our software engineers are master coders who are passionate about technology, and have a deep appreciation and understanding of algorithms and data structures.

As part of this team, you will be working on very interesting problems in numerous domains such as Distributed Computing, Information Retrieval, Data Mining, Natural Language Processing, and other cutting-edge Web 2.0 technologies.

This position is based in Singapore.

Requirements:

  • BS or MS in Computer Science or equivalent, PhD in Computer Science a plus.
  • 3+ years of direct software development experience.
  • Fresh graduates with exceptional coding and/or scripting skills will be considered.
  • Has excellent communication and teamwork skills
  • Excellent coding skills in C, C++, or Java, Python is a plus.
  • Good scripting skills in at least one common language (Perl, Python, Shell).
  • Highly proficient in a Unix/Linux environment.
  • Strong knowledge of internet technologies.
  • Fluency in one of the following languages: English, Chinese, or Japanese. Candidates with bilingual skills will be advantaged.
  • Knowledge and experience in databases (e.g. PostgreSQL, MySQL, BekerleyDB, etc.), especially in database tuning, analytical databases, and large-scale production databases is a plus.
  • Knowledge, Qualifications and/or experience in either of these fields will be a plus: Web Analytics, Statistics, Data Mining, Artificial Intelligence, Natural Language Processing, Distributed Search, Distributed Computing, User Interface Design, Usability

At Circos, we only hire “A” players and the most passionate people we can find. If you think you have what it takes, please email your resume & tell us why you are the right person for this job.

We will be contacting all shortlisted candidates. Good luck!